Microsoft хочет, чтобы сайты сами общались с пользователями, а не ждали милости от Bing.
Microsoft представила на конференции Build 2025 новый открытый протокол NLWeb — технологию, которую её создатель Раманатан В. Гуха считает частью четвёртой революции в персональных вычислениях. По его словам, после графических интерфейсов, интернета и мобильных устройств наступает новая эра — взаимодействие с компьютерами с помощью естественного языка.
В отличие от централизованных решений вроде ChatGPT или Bing, NLWeb позволяет любому сайту или приложению самостоятельно внедрить функции взаимодействия на базе ИИ. С помощью нескольких строк кода, выбранной модели и собственных данных владелец ресурса может запустить чат-интерфейс, который будет отвечать на вопросы пользователей. Протокол принимает запрос на естественном языке и возвращает структурированный ответ, а все данные и запросы обрабатываются на стороне самого сайта, без выхода за его пределы.
Гуха показал несколько примеров. На сайте Serious Eats он ввёл запрос: «что-то острое и хрустящее, что подойдёт в качестве закуски». Через пару секунд система предложила подходящие ссылки. Затем он добавил, что готовит к празднику Дивали и придерживается вегетарианской диеты. NLWeb запомнил это и продолжил давать только вегетарианские рекомендации.
Другой пример — поиск тёплой куртки для поездки в Квебек на сайте ритейлера. Результат — список товаров с фотографиями и дополнительной информацией, сформированный с учётом погодных условий. По словам Гухи, система «понимает контекст и отображает информацию так, чтобы в неё можно было встроить, например, спонсорские ссылки».
Идея в том, что каждый разработчик может внедрить такую систему у себя, не полагаясь на внешние сервисы и не надеясь, что пользователь получит нужную ссылку из общего чат-бота. Уже идут пилоты с TripAdvisor, Eventbrite, Shopify и другими платформами. Вместо частных соглашений с поставщиками ИИ, как сейчас у Shopify с OpenAI, NLWeb предлагает единый открытый протокол.
Кроме того, технология дешёвая. По словам Гухи, в отличие от классического веб-поиска с затратами на индексацию, здесь можно просто взять RSS-ленту сайта, загрузить её в векторную базу и использовать модель вроде GPT-4o Mini или более доступные варианты. Всё работает быстро, недорого и с возможностью постоянного уточнения запроса.
Раманатан В. Гуха — фигура с весомым авторитетом в мире открытого веба. Он участвовал в создании RSS и Schema.org — технологий, ставших стандартом. Работал в Netscape, Google, Apple. Сейчас он уверен: NLWeb может сделать веб по-настоящему интерактивным — без потери контроля над данными и без зависимости от крупных платформ.
Интерес Microsoft тоже понятен. Компания рассчитывает, что после внедрения протокола сайты начнут подключать к нему решения на базе Azure или Copilot. NLWeb также поддерживает Model Context Protocol (MCP), разработанный компанией Anthropic.
Пока основная цель — улучшение поиска по сайту. Но дальше могут возникнуть более сложные вопросы: должен ли сайт передавать предпочтения пользователя другим платформам? Может ли система действовать от его имени — например, делать заказы? Кто и как должен управлять данными? Гуха подчёркивает, что ответы на эти вопросы должны найти сами пользователи и разработчики.
Но есть и вызов: чтобы NLWeb стал стандартом, его должны поддержать. Компании вроде Meta или Google могут пойти по собственному пути. История веба показывает — всё рано или поздно централизуется. Но если раньше у агрегаторов действительно были лучшие технологии, то теперь они могут быть доступны каждому. И это шанс на новый поворот в развитии интернета.